- What are polyelectrolyte brushes (PEBs)?
- When the polyelectrolytes or zwitterionic polymers are attached with one chain-end to the substrate at a density that is high enough for the polymers to stretch away from the grafting plane, so-called polyelectrolyte brushes (PEBs) (42−44) are formed. They can be prepared by grafting to (45) or grafting from (46) techniques.
